what oil has dha Exactly is DHA? The Maximum Building Block

DHA is one of typically the three main types of Omega-3 oily acids (alongside EPA and ALA). It is called a "good fat" because this is an fundamental essential fatty acid, meaning the body cannot develop it efficiently about its own; an individual must obtain this through diet or perhaps supplementation.

Unlike additional fats which can be merely used for energy, DHA is a new fundamental structural aspect of the body. In fact, DHA makes up about 97% of the particular Omega-3s found inside of the brain or more to 93% in the Omega-3s in the particular retina of typically the eye.

Think of it as the specialized, high-quality mortar required to develop and maintain the particular most intricate systems in your entire body.

The best 3 Tasks of DHA found in the Body

DHA doesn't just handle one system; it’s a required vitamin for development, restoration, and optimal functionality across your life expectancy.

1. The Head Booster: Cognition plus Memory

Your head is roughly 60% fat, and DHA plays a major role in its composition. It helps keep the fluidity regarding cell membranes, which often is crucial intended for efficient communication in between neurons.

Benefits consist of:

Improved Cognitive Functionality: Studies link higher DHA intake to better working memory plus focus in individuals.

Mood Regulation: Adequate Omega-3s are important for neurotransmitter purpose, potentially helping to stabilize mood plus reduce symptoms associated with mild depression.

Neuroprotection: DHA is becoming researched extensively intended for its role inside fighting age-related intellectual decline and supporting brain health as we age.

2. The Eye-sight Protector: Eye Well being

The highest attentiveness of DHA outside the brain is found in the retina. DHA is major to the growth and performance of the particular photoreceptor cells, which usually are responsible for converting light into signals the human brain can interpret.

Sustaining healthy DHA extremes is often offered by ophthalmologists as being a key strategy with regard to supporting long-term eye into the reducing typically the risk of typical age-related vision problems.

3. Critical for Maternal and Infant Wellness

If a person are pregnant or breastfeeding, DHA is arguably the most important supplement you might take. During this period, the mother’s DHA stores will be heavily utilized to create the fetal in addition to infant brain, nervous system, and eye.

Key benefits with regard to infants:

Optimal Mind Development: Supports typically the rapid growth associated with the baby’s main nervous system in the third trimester plus first two many years of life.

Much better Motor Skills: Exploration suggests adequate DHA may correlate along with improved fine electric motor skills and hand-eye coordination in early on childhood.

Where you can get The DHA: Fish versus. Algae

While the body can convert the tiny amount regarding ALA (found in flax or chia seeds) into DHA, the conversion charge is incredibly low—often much less than 1%—making immediate sources essential.

Whenever seeking DHA petrol, you generally have two excellent options:

1. Fish Oil (The Traditional Source)

Cold-water, fatty fish—such like salmon, mackerel, sardines, and sardines—are affluent sources of Omega-3s. Most standard species of fish oil supplements have both EPA in addition to DHA.

2. Climber Oil (The Plant-Based Alternative)

Here is the secret: Seafood don't produce DHA; they accumulate it by eating microalgae (or smaller species of fish that ate typically the algae).

Algae petrol cuts out the middle fish, offering a direct, lasting, and vegan way to obtain DHA. If an individual are vegetarian, vegetarian, or simply concerned with sustainability and mercury, algae oil is the ideal choice.

Do You Need a DHA Supplement?

While a diet rich in fatty fish may provide sufficient DHA, many people are unsuccessful of recommended day to day goals, especially these who:

Do not eat fish: Vegans, vegetarians, and others together with fish allergies.

Are usually pregnant or breastfeeding a baby: Needs are drastically higher to aid embrionario development.

Are getting older: Supplementation can support cognitive maintenance.

Have specific medical concerns: Disorders related to center health, inflammation, or even neurological issues might warrant higher dosage, always under some sort of doctor's guidance.

Getting Notes on Dosage

There is zero universal dosage, because needs vary substantially. However, most health organizations recommend a combined daily absorption of 250–500 magnesium of EPA plus DHA for healthful adults. For pregnant/nursing women, the minimum DHA recommendation is often closer to 300–400 mg daily.
